Composition / Information on Ingredients

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ification

Type mixture
Chemical Name CAS Number Concentration Hazardous
Solvent naphtha (petroleum), heavy arom. 64742-94-5 10 - 30% Yes
Triethanolamine 102-71-6 5 - 10% Yes
2-Butoxyethanol 111-76-2 5 - 10% Yes
2-methylpentane-2,4-diol 107-41-5 1 - 5% Yes
Naphthalene 91-20-3 1 - 5% Yes
Surfactant --- 1 - 5% Yes
Polyalkylene --- 1 - 5% Yes
rosin 8050-09-7 1 - 5% Yes
Cumene 98-82-8 0.1 - 1% Yes
Benzene 71-43-2 0.1% Yes

* Exact percentages may vary or are trade secret. Concentration range is provided to assist users in providing appropriate protections.

04

First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

If inhaled, immediately remove the affected person to fresh air. If symptoms develop and persist, get medical attention.

Skin contact

Immediately wash skin thoroughly with soap and water. If symptoms develop and persist, get medical attention.

Eye contact

In case of contact with the eyes, rinse immediately with plenty of water for 15 minutes, and seek immediate medical attention.

Ingestion

Get immediate medical attention. Do not induce vomiting.

Immediate Medical Attention

Get immediate medical attention.

Medical Treatment

Treat symptomatically and supportively.

05

Firefighting Measures

Extinguishing media, specific hazards, and firefighter protection

Suitable media

Water spray (fog), foam, dry chemical or carbon dioxide.

Specific hazards

May liberate large quantities of dense, foul-smelling smoke which may contain unidentified toxic gasses.

Instructions

Wear full protective clothing. Wear self-contained breathing apparatus.

Firefighter Protection

Wear full protective clothing. Wear self-contained breathing apparatus.

06

Accidental Release Measures

Spill cleanup procedures, containment, and environmental protection

Emergency procedures

isolate the hazard area and deny entry to unnecessary and unprotected personnel.

Environmental

Prevent further leakage or spillage if safe to do so. Wear appropriate protective equipment and clothing during clean-up. Do not allow product to enter sewer or waterways.

Cleanup methods

Absorb spill with inert material. Shovel material into appropriate container for disposal.

Materials: inert material

10

Stability and Reactivity

Chemical stability, hazardous reactions, and incompatible materials

Stability

Stable under normal conditions of storage and use.

Reactivity

Not available.

Hazardous reactions

None under normal processing.

Avoid

Keep away from heat, ignition sources and incompatible materials.

Incompatible

This product may react with strong acids or oxidizing agents.

Decomposition

Upon decomposition, this product emits carbon monoxide, carbon dioxide and/or low molecular weight hydrocarbons. Oxides of nitrogen.
